What do you mean as good..? two examples, alive directory and epitrope both maintain PR7 homepages, with many PR7-5 inner pages allow keywords within the title. It depends in my opinion on what the directory is for, finding the information or finding a company. If you don't allow keywords in a title your having people give you their company name, for example my company would have the title "Pacific Prime" if it could not use keywords within the title. However if the directory was for categorizing information the title would be one of my keyword phrases such as "international health insurance" which accurately describes the information contained in my site.
